Transaction 62eb523e69ed8ebd36cd697323161532fe764ef7d155df6f082725e5546af183
1 Input
2 Outputs
- 62eb523e69ed8ebd36cd697323161532fe764ef7d155df6f082725e5546af183:0
- 62eb523e69ed8ebd36cd697323161532fe764ef7d155df6f082725e5546af183:1
value 14161553
address 2N16oE62ZjAPup985dFBQYAuy5zpDraH7Hk
value 516593
address n17ppGj4baTFpcgRUh4CQ7hx5qCfofpJrY